Ordinals
beta
Address 3MbTun45CphLkNKdeDKsvWHmbaTob2U931
sat balance
16000
runes balances
outputs
608dddbf5ff02deafbac006aae0a980c2dab4281b1acd51659b442f6da1cef0e:1